I am currently experiencing a voice delay at around 0.5 seconds, meaning my voice is coming 0.5 seconds later than the rest of the stream, camera etc.

I found the setting to correct this under "Audio", called "Mic Sync Offset", but I seem to be capped at -60 when trying to correct the delay. I can clearly tell that it reduces my current voice delay, but I can't seem to lower it more than -60 for some reason.

One of my friends had the exact same issue and was able to fix it, by setting "Mic Sync Offset" to -600.
 

FerretBomb

Active Member
Increase your Scene Buffering Time in Settings->Advanced to be about 400ms longer than your adjustment delay. So if you wanted to use -600ms, make sure the SBT is set to at least 1000ms.
